NITI Aayog’s AIM announces ATL Tinkerpreneur 2024 boot camp for students- All you need to know

The Atal Innovation Mission (AIM), NITI Aayog, has announced the commencement of applications for the ‘ATL Tinkerpreneur 2024’- a summer boot camp under AIM’s Atal Tinkering Labs program. Starting on June 20, 2024, this boot camp is now open to all schools across India including non ATL schools.

ATL Tinkerpreneur 2024 promises to be a transformative experience for participating students (Class 6 to Class 12). Over a span of 40 days, from June to July, participants will embark on a virtual journey aimed at equipping them with essential digital skills and frameworks. By the end of the boot camp, students will have the tools and knowledge to conceptualize and develop their own online ventures.

Registered teams will benefit from dedicated mentoring throughout the boot camp period by AIM’s dedicated mentors across the country under ‘Mentor India Initiative’. From June 20th to July 25th, students can engage in expert sessions covering digital, product, and entrepreneurship skills, supplemented by tailored handholding sessions for a more focused approach. 

During the program, acquire digital skills, build a digital product including an app or website, learn about business finance, create a brand and market their product, develop a business model, refine the digital product, setting up an online store, launch online business and make a compelling pitch present to customers and investors.
